Samples of the indoor air and the outdoors air ought to be taken for contrast. There ought to not be any kind of mold and mildew inside your house that is not discovered outside. The focus of mold and mildew inside a home ought to not be greater than the focus of mold outside. Mold and mildew spores in the air being sampled can vary considerably in relationship to the life cycle of the mold, climatic and ecological conditions, and moved here the quantity of air flow.
